What little I know of him is he was in the Reichsmarine until he became a.D. 30.11.22. (m.Char. als K.Kapt.)
He was also in the Kriegsmarine being promoted Kapt.z.S. 1.12.40 and discharged 31.12.44.

He was involved with Fabrikationsabteilung für Industrielle (RüWi IV) etc. between 21.07.40 and 10.43.
